Linux Today: Linux News On Internet Time.

Most Read Stories

More on LinuxToday

Articles by Opensource.com

Locks versus channels in concurrent Go (Jul 14, 2018)

How to set up DevPI, a PyPI-compatible Python development server (Jul 14, 2018)

How developers can get involved with open source networking (Jul 13, 2018)

An introduction to Go arrays and slices (Jul 12, 2018)

A sysadmin's guide to SELinux: 42 answers to the big questions (Jul 12, 2018)

What are cloud-native applications? (Jul 12, 2018)

Building hearing aids with a Linux-based open hardware board (Jul 12, 2018)

A sysadmin's guide to network management (Jul 10, 2018)

Getting started with Perlbrew (Jul 10, 2018)

15 open source applications for MacOS (Jul 10, 2018)

5 Firefox extensions to protect your privacy (Jul 09, 2018)

6 RFCs for understanding how the internet works (Jul 09, 2018)

Wallabag: An open source alternative to Pocket (Jul 07, 2018)

How do you keep your Linux skills strong? (Jul 06, 2018)

How to make a career move from proprietary to open source technology (Jul 06, 2018)

10 killer tools for the admin in a hurry (Jul 03, 2018)

How to edit Adobe InDesign files with Scribus and Gedit (Jul 03, 2018)

How to plan projects in the open, without the stress (Jul 01, 2018)

Running integration tests in Kubernetes (Jun 30, 2018)

Happy birthday GPLv3! An insider's look at drafting the GPLv3 license (Jun 30, 2018)

Celebrating 24 years of FreeDOS: Useful commands cheat sheet (Jun 30, 2018)

Blockchain evolution: A quick guide and why open source is at the heart of it (Jun 29, 2018)

4 ways Flutter makes mobile app development delightful (Jun 28, 2018)

Facebook partners on open source AI development tools ONNX and PyTorch 1.0 (Jun 28, 2018)

3 ways to copy files in Go (Jun 25, 2018)

8 reasons to use the Xfce Linux desktop environment (Jun 25, 2018)

Take your computer on the go with Portable Apps (Jun 24, 2018)

Balancing transparency and privacy as big data meets HR (Jun 22, 2018)

How to connect to a remote desktop from Linux (Jun 22, 2018)

Troubleshooting a Buildah script (Jun 22, 2018)

Anatomy of a perfect pull request (Jun 21, 2018)

Getting started with React Native animations (Jun 21, 2018)

Try this vi setup to keep and organize your notes (Jun 20, 2018)

How to reset, revert, and return to previous states in Git (Jun 20, 2018)

Write fast apps with Pronghorn, a Java framework (Jun 19, 2018)

BLUI: An easy way to create game UI (Jun 17, 2018)

Bash tips for everyday at the command line (Jun 15, 2018)

Introducing a Groff Macros cheat sheet (Jun 14, 2018)

Better API testing with the OpenAPI Specification (Jun 13, 2018)

What version of Linux am I running? (Jun 13, 2018)

3 open source alternatives to Adobe Lightroom (Jun 13, 2018)

How to partition a disk in Linux (Jun 13, 2018)

How to use screen scraping tools to extract data from the web (Jun 09, 2018)

Using MQTT to send and receive data for your next project (Jun 07, 2018)

3 journaling applications for the Linux desktop (Jun 07, 2018)

Learning to be open without turning into a mesmerized chicken (Jun 07, 2018)

Getting started with Buildah (Jun 07, 2018)

How to use the history command in Linux (Jun 06, 2018)

How to use autofs to mount NFS shares (Jun 05, 2018)

MySQL without the MySQL: An introduction to the MySQL Document Store (Jun 05, 2018)

Pages:  1 2 3 >  Last ›